    /**

     * 下载文件,实现断点续传,添加range到header

     * @param url

     * @param destFile

     * @return

     */

    public static File downloadBreakpointContinuingly(String url, File destFile, DownloadCallback cb) {

        RandomAccessFile raf = null;

        InputStream input = null;

        long fileSize = 0;

        String errorMsg = null;

        try {

            Log.d(TAG, "Starting download file : " + destFile + " , url: " + url);

            new File(destFile.getParent()).mkdirs();

            fileSize = getDownloadFileSize(url);

            destFile.createNewFile();

            raf = new RandomAccessFile(destFile, "rw");

            long downloaded = raf.length();

            if(cb != null) {

                cb.onStart(downloaded, fileSize);

            }

            Log.d(TAG, "should download rest filesize: " + (fileSize - downloaded));

            HttpGet get = getHttpGet(url, raf.length(), -1);

            HttpResponse response = getHttpClient().execute(get);

            int code = response.getStatusLine().getStatusCode();

            Log.d(TAG, "download file return code: " + code);

            if (code == HttpStatus.SC_PARTIAL_CONTENT) {

                raf.seek(destFile.length());

                errorMsg = "HttpStatus.SC_PARTIAL_CONTENT";

            } else if (code == HttpStatus.SC_NOT_FOUND) {

                errorMsg = "HttpStatus.SC_NOT_FOUND";

                return null;

            } else if (code != HttpStatus.SC_OK) {

                errorMsg = "code != HttpStatus.SC_OK !! code= " + code;

                return null;

            }

            long restFileSize = response.getEntity().getContentLength();

            Log.d(TAG, "try download rest file size=" + restFileSize);

            // TODO 最好先检查存储空间,面的写数据失败

            input = response.getEntity().getContent();

            byte data[] = new byte[4096];

            int count;

            while ((count = input.read(data)) != -1) {

                raf.write(data, 0, count);

                int progress = fileSize == 0 ? 0 : (int) (raf.length() * 100 / fileSize);

                if(cb != null) {

                    cb.onProgress(progress, raf.length(), fileSize);

                }

            }

        } catch (Exception e) {

            e.printStackTrace();

            Log.w(TAG, e.toString());

        } finally {

            try {

                input.close();

            } catch (IOException e) {

                e.printStackTrace();

            }

            try {

                raf.close();

            } catch (IOException e) {

                e.printStackTrace();

            }

            if(cb != null) {

                cb.OnFinished(true, fileSize, errorMsg);

            }

        }

        return destFile;

    }

    /**

     * 实现断点续传,添加range到header

     * 注意点: range区间不能指定end,否则在某些情况下(如阿里云服务器)不生效),不指定end绘制解把文件读完整

     * @param url

     * @param start

     * @return

     */

    protected static HttpGet getHttpGet(String url, long start, long end) {

        HttpGet httpGet = new HttpGet(url);

        if(start >= 0) {

            StringBuffer range = new StringBuffer("bytes=" + start + "-");

            if(end > start) {

                range.append(end);

            }

            Header headerRange = new BasicHeader("Range", range.toString());

            Log.d(TAG, "range header: " + headerRange);

            httpGet.addHeader(headerRange);

        }

        return httpGet;

    }

    /**

     * 如果尚未知道文件的下载大小,则先主动获取一下

     */

    private static long getDownloadFileSize(String url) {

        long fileSize = 0;

        try {

            HttpGet get = getHttpGet(url, 0, -1);

            fileSize = getHttpClient().execute(get).getEntity().getContentLength();

        } catch (ClientProtocolException e) {

            e.printStackTrace();

        } catch (IOException e) {

            e.printStackTrace();

        }

        return fileSize;

    }
